What it does
Connect your Shopify store and choose which products sell online. Stockroom pushes the catalog and keeps the counts in step, and web orders arrive here to pick, pack and ship, with the tracking email sent back automatically.
- You decide what sells online, per product, and how many to hold back for the counter.
- Sell one at the till and the storefront knows immediately. No overnight batch, no scheduled job.
- Already on Shopify? Import your existing catalog once so products match up instead of duplicating.
- Web orders land as real orders here, reserving stock while they wait to be picked.
- On Growth and above, an order short on stock ships what you have and the rest becomes a backorder your reorder list already knows about.
- Fulfil here and Shopify emails your customer on its own. Add a carrier and tracking number and it goes in that email.
- Cancellations and returns behave properly: stock only comes back when the goods do.
- Independent of Square. Run either, both, or neither. Neither one needs the other.
